Modular Home decor Vs. regular Home decor
Modular home decor differs from regular home decor in a few key ways:
- Design and Construction: Modular homes are built using prefabricated modules in a factory-controlled environment. This construction method allows for greater precision and efficiency, resulting in a more streamlined and standardized design compared to traditional stick-built homes. The modular design often incorporates elements that can be easily assembled, disassembled, or rearranged, allowing for greater flexibility in decor choices.
- Flexibility and Adaptability: Modular homes are designed to be adaptable to changing needs and preferences. The modular design allows homeowners to customize and modify their living spaces more easily compared to traditional homes. This flexibility extends to the decor as well, with modular furniture and storage solutions that can be adjusted or expanded as needed.
- Space Optimization: Modular homes are known for their efficient use of space. They are designed to maximize every square foot, making them ideal for smaller or more compact living areas. Decor options in modular homes often prioritize functionality and multi-purpose design to optimize space utilization without compromising style.
- Budget Considerations: Decorating a modular home can be more cost-effective compared to regular homes. The modular construction process allows for better cost control, resulting in potential savings on the overall construction budget. Additionally, the flexibility in decor choices and the availability of modular furniture options at different price points can accommodate various budget ranges.
- Energy Efficiency: Many modular homes are designed with energy efficiency in mind. They often incorporate features such as energy-efficient windows, insulation, and appliances. Energy-efficient decor choices, such as LED lighting or smart home systems, can further enhance the eco-friendly aspect of modular homes.
- Ease of Installation: Modular decor options are designed to be easily installed or assembled. This convenience can simplify the process of decorating a modular home, as compared to the potential complexities and time associated with extensive renovations in regular homes.
In summary, modular home decor offers a combination of flexibility, efficiency, adaptability, and potential cost savings. It embraces a design philosophy that is focused on maximizing space, accommodating changing needs, and providing a customizable living environment.
Can I use regular home decor items for my Modular home?
Yes, you can certainly use regular home decor items in your modular home. Modular homes are designed to be versatile and adaptable, allowing you to incorporate a wide range of decor items to suit your personal style and preferences.
Here are a few considerations when using regular home decor items in a modular home:
- Scale and Proportion: Pay attention to the scale and proportion of the decor items you choose. Modular homes often have open floor plans and may feature smaller rooms compared to traditional homes. Ensure that the size of your decor items complements the space and doesn’t overwhelm it.
- Functionality: Consider the functionality of the decor items. Modular homes often prioritize efficient use of space, so selecting decor items that serve a purpose beyond aesthetics can be beneficial. For example, choose furniture with built-in storage or multipurpose functionality to maximize space utilization.
- Flexibility: Modular homes offer the advantage of easily reconfigurable spaces. When selecting decor items, consider their adaptability to different layouts or room arrangements. Modular furniture or decor elements that can be easily moved, rearranged, or repurposed can provide flexibility as your needs change.
- Style and Aesthetics: Your modular home can reflect your personal style, and regular home decor items can help achieve that. Consider your desired decor style and choose items that align with it. Whether it’s modern, traditional, bohemian, or eclectic, select pieces that create the desired ambiance in your modular home.
- Integration: Regular home decor items can seamlessly integrate into a modular home. Blend them with the modular elements already present in your home, such as modular furniture or built-in storage solutions. Harmonizing different design elements can create a cohesive and unified look.
- Safety and Weight Considerations: Keep in mind any weight restrictions or safety guidelines specific to your modular home. Some modular homes have specific guidelines regarding wall-mounted items or heavy fixtures. Ensure that your decor items adhere to these guidelines to maintain structural integrity.
Remember, the beauty of decorating a modular home lies in its adaptability and customization. Feel free to mix and match regular home decor items with modular-specific elements to create a unique and personalized space that suits your taste and lifestyle.

b. Bedroom:
Your bedroom should be a sanctuary that promotes relaxation and organization. With modular bedroom decor ideas, you can create a personalized and functional space:
- Opt for modular wardrobes with customizable storage compartments: Modular wardrobes with adjustable shelves, drawers, and hanging rails can adapt to your changing storage needs. Customize the interior layout to accommodate your clothing, accessories, and personal belongings efficiently.
- Install modular bedside tables with built-in storage: Choose bedside tables with modular designs that offer hidden storage compartments or removable elements. This way, you can keep your essentials close at hand while maintaining a clutter-free bedroom.
- Explore modular headboards that can be easily reconfigured: Consider a modular headboard system that allows you to mix and match different panels or elements. This provides you with the freedom to change the look of your bedroom effortlessly.

c. Kitchen:
The kitchen is the heart of any home, and a well-designed modular kitchen can significantly enhance its functionality and aesthetics. Consider the following modular decor ideas for your kitchen:
- Install modular kitchen cabinets for flexible storage options: Opt for modular kitchen cabinets with adjustable shelves and drawers. This allows you to customize the storage space based on your specific needs and the size of your kitchenware.
- Utilize modular kitchen islands for additional workspace: If you have space, incorporate a modular kitchen island that offers additional countertop space and storage options. Look for islands with detachable or movable components for increased flexibility.
- Incorporate modular shelves and racks for organizing utensils and appliances: Install modular shelving units or racks in your kitchen to keep utensils, spices, and small appliances organized. Choose designs that can be easily rearranged or expanded as your needs change.

d. Bathroom:
Even the bathroom can benefit from modular decor ideas, making it a functional and stylish space. Consider the following suggestions:
- Install modular vanity units with adjustable storage options: Opt for modular vanity units that offer adjustable shelves, drawers, and compartments. This allows you to tailor the storage space to accommodate your toiletries and personal care items effectively.
- Use modular shower shelves for storing toiletries: Incorporate modular shower shelves that can be easily attached or detached. This provides you with convenient storage space for your shampoo, conditioner, and shower essentials.
- Consider modular mirror cabinets for maximizing storage space: Install modular mirror cabinets above the bathroom sink. These cabinets offer a combination of mirrors and storage compartments, allowing you to efficiently utilize vertical space in your bathroom.

is decorating Modular Homes Expensive?
The cost of decorating modular homes can vary depending on several factors, including the extent of the decor changes, the materials used, and individual preferences.
However, decorating modular homes can often be more cost-effective compared to traditional homes for several reasons:
- Flexibility in design: Modular homes are designed with flexibility in mind, allowing for easy customization and modification. This means that you have the freedom to choose decor elements that fit your budget without compromising on style.
- Modular furniture options: Modular furniture, which is designed to be versatile and adaptable, is often more affordable than custom-built furniture. With modular furniture, you can mix and match pieces to create a personalized and functional space without breaking the bank.
- Efficient use of space: Modular homes are designed to maximize space utilization, often incorporating clever storage solutions. This can reduce the need for additional storage furniture, saving both money and space.
- DIY options: Decorating a modular home provides opportunities for do-it-yourself (DIY) projects. DIY decor projects can be cost-effective and allow you to add a personal touch to your home without hiring professionals or purchasing expensive pre-made items.
- Energy efficiency: Modular homes are known for their energy efficiency, which can lead to long-term cost savings on utility bills. By incorporating energy-efficient decor elements such as LED lighting, smart thermostats, and efficient appliances, you can further enhance the energy-saving benefits of your modular home.
While decorating a modular home can be done on a budget, it’s important to plan and prioritize your decor choices.
Consider researching affordable decor options, repurposing existing items, and utilizing sales or discounts to make the most of your budget.
By being resourceful and creative, you can achieve a stylish and personalized modular home decor without breaking the bank.
Decorating Modular Home FAQs
- Are there limitations to decorating a modular home?
While modular homes offer flexibility in design and decor, there may be some limitations based on the specific layout and structure of the home.
For example, structural elements such as load-bearing walls may restrict certain modifications. However, with careful planning and working within the existing framework, you can still achieve a personalized and stylish interior.
- Can I customize the interior finishes of a modular home?
Yes, one of the advantages of modular homes is the ability to customize the interior finishes. You can choose from a variety of flooring, cabinetry, countertops, paint colors, and fixtures to create a look that suits your preferences and style.
- How do I choose the right decor style for my modular home?
Choosing a decor style for your modular home depends on your personal taste and the overall aesthetic you want to achieve.
Consider factors such as the home’s architecture, natural lighting, and lifestyle. Browse design magazines, websites, and social media platforms for inspiration and create mood boards to help you visualize the desired style.

- How can I make my modular home feel more spacious?
To create a sense of spaciousness in a modular home, use light colors on the walls and ceilings to reflect natural light.
Opt for furniture with a slim profile and prioritize open floor plans. Utilize mirrors strategically to create an illusion of depth, and incorporate multi-functional furniture to maximize space utilization.
- Are there cost-effective decor options for a modular home?
Yes, there are many cost-effective decor options for a modular home. Consider shopping at thrift stores, flea markets, or online marketplaces for unique and affordable pieces.
DIY projects can also be a budget-friendly option, allowing you to personalize your space without spending a fortune. Additionally, repurposing or updating existing furniture and decor items can save money.
- How can I add personal touches to my modular home?
Adding personal touches to your modular home is essential for creating a cozy and inviting space. Display personal photographs, artwork, and mementos that hold sentimental value.
Incorporate items that reflect your hobbies and interests, such as books, collectibles, or travel souvenirs.
Customizable elements like throw pillows, curtains, and rugs can also infuse your personality into the decor.
